Section 5: Appointment of Inspector

The Tripura Agricultural Workers Act,1986State Act of Tripura · Act 9 of 1986

(1) The Government may, by notification in the Official Gazette, appoint— 4a) such officers, or such person .as possess, the prescribed qualification, as they think fit, to be Inspectors for the purposes of this Act and, define the local limits within which they shall exercise their’ powers.

(2) Subject to rules made in this behalf, an Inspector may, within the local limits for which he is appointed,—

(a) enter, at any time after sunrise and before sunset with such assistants, being persons in the service of the Government or any local or other public authority, as he thinks fit, prémises or places _ where agricultural workers are employed or where he has reasons to believe that records are Kept, for the prupose of examining any register or record of wages required to be kept under this Act ‘or the rule made thereunder and require the production thereof for inspection ;

(b) examine any person who he finds in any such premises or place and whom he has resonable cause to belizve to be an agricultural worker ;

(c). seize or take copies of such register or record or portions thereof as he may consider relevant in respect of an offerice under this Act which he has reason to believe has been committed by a landowner ; and

(d) exercise such other powers as may be prescribed,.

(3) Until Inspectors are appointed under this Act the - Inspectors appointed under the Minimum Wages. Act (Central Act II of 1948), shall be deemed to be Inspectors appointed under this Act for the area in which they exercise jurisdiction under the said Act.
